Freedom Railway


‘Freedom Railway’ is a project about the railway between Dar es Salaam (Tanzania) and Kapiri Mposhi (Zambia). The railway is one of the first infrastructural investments China made on the African continent. At the opening ceremony in 1976, the railway was branded as the ‘Uhuru Railway,’ using the Kiswahili word for ‘freedom.’ While the railway is not living up to its economic potential, still thousands of people use the trains to go to otherwise isolated places along the tracks.
